aboutsummaryrefslogtreecommitdiffstats
path: root/launcher/src/homescreenhandler.h
diff options
context:
space:
mode:
authorwang_zhiqiang <wang_zhiqiang@dl.cn.nexty-ele.com>2019-05-28 14:02:08 +0800
committerwang_zhiqiang <wang_zhiqiang@dl.cn.nexty-ele.com>2019-05-28 14:02:08 +0800
commit3508d025b0046fffb337ffceb912947ef1dcf47d (patch)
treec2665aa357bda0132a6134621c9cacd0b2795200 /launcher/src/homescreenhandler.h
parent353da85004c72efb2bd6f117a15713b58e0df866 (diff)
registerShortcut
Change-Id: Ia05d26a3e14f6b35e53f70c116e5b422518883a4
Diffstat (limited to 'launcher/src/homescreenhandler.h')
-rw-r--r--launcher/src/homescreenhandler.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/launcher/src/homescreenhandler.h b/launcher/src/homescreenhandler.h
index 6f0602d..e612331 100644
--- a/launcher/src/homescreenhandler.h
+++ b/launcher/src/homescreenhandler.h
@@ -37,6 +37,10 @@ public:
Q_INVOKABLE void tapShortcut(QString application_id);
Q_INVOKABLE void getRunnables(void);
+ Q_INVOKABLE void hideWindow(QString application_id);
+ Q_INVOKABLE void registerShortcut(QString shortcut_id, QString shortcut_name, QString position);
+ Q_INVOKABLE int uninstallApplication(QString application_id);
+ Q_INVOKABLE void sendAppToMeter(QString application_id);
void onRep(struct json_object* reply_contents);
@@ -47,6 +51,7 @@ public:
signals:
void initAppList(QString data);
void appListUpdate(QStringList info);
+ void updateShortcutList(QStringList shortcut_list);
private:
QLibHomeScreen *mp_qhs;